Barcelona have made it clear that they will not allow any player to leave in the January transfer window, but there may be one exception: Isaac Cuenca.
The winger is on the verge of receiving the medical all-clear after undergoing surgery on his knee in the summer.
However, the 21-year-old will naturally find it difficult to win a place in the Barcelona starting line-up in the near future, with Leo Messi, Pedro, Cristian Tello, Alexis Sánchez and David Villa all ahead of him in the pecking order.
Valencia have been keeping an eye on his availability and if he were to go anywhere in January it would be to the Mestalla.
The excellent relations between Barcelona sporting director Andoni Zubizarreta and Valencia coach Ernesto Valverde mean the deal could be easier to pull off than first thought. Furthermore, Barcelona's directors believe that 'Los Ché' could provide Cuenca with the games Tito Vilanova or Jordi Roura would not be able to guarantee him, for obvious reasons.
The move would mean the youngster would not miss an entire season, and could recover his form and fitness in the next five months and return to Barcelona next summer ready to fight for a place in the team again.
